The Importance of Regular Deck Maintenance

Ensuring your deck remains a durable and attractive feature of your home requires regular maintenance. Whether your deck is made of natural wood or composite materials, routine care is crucial to extend its life, prevent costly repairs, and maintain its safety and aesthetic appeal. Here are the essential steps for keeping your deck in top condition:

  1. Cleaning: Annually clean your deck to remove dirt, grime, and any mildew. For wood decks, use a gentle cleaner suitable for the wood type. Composite decks can be cleaned with soap and water or a composite deck cleaner.
  2. Inspection: Regularly inspect your deck for signs of wear, including loose boards, protruding nails, or damaged railings. Address these issues promptly to maintain safety.
  3. Staining and Sealing (for wood decks): Every 2-3 years, apply a stain or sealant to protect the wood from moisture, UV rays, and insect damage. Choose a product appropriate for your deck’s wood type.
  4. Repair: Make necessary repairs as soon as damage is detected. This includes tightening loose screws, replacing damaged boards, and ensuring railings and stairs are secure.
  5. Protection: Take preventive measures to protect your deck from damage. This might include using grill mats to catch grease, furniture pads to prevent scratches, and removing snow in the winter to avoid moisture buildup.
  6. Mold and Mildew Treatment: Specifically for composite decks, use a cleaner designed to remove mold and mildew without damaging the material.

By following these steps, you can maintain the structure, appearance, and safety of your deck, ensuring it continues to be a valuable addition to your home for many years. Knowing Your Deck and Its Maintenance Needs

Understanding the specific maintenance needs of your deck begins with identifying its material, as the care required for wood versus composite decking varies significantly. Recognizing these differences ensures you can adopt a maintenance approach that’s not only effective but also appropriate for the material you’re working with. Here’s a breakdown to guide you:

How to Maintain a Wood Deck

Wood decks, cherished for their natural beauty and warmth, demand a higher level of maintenance to preserve their condition and extend their lifespan.

  • Cleaning: Annual cleaning with a wood-specific cleaner to remove dirt and prevent mold and mildew buildup.
  • Staining/Sealing: Requires staining or sealing every 2-3 years to protect against moisture, UV damage, and wear, which can lead to splintering and discoloration.
  • Inspection: Frequent inspections for signs of rot, insect damage, or structural issues are crucial, as wood is more susceptible to these problems.

How to Maintain a Composite Deck

Composite decking, celebrated for its durability and low maintenance, still requires care to maintain its appearance and longevity.

  • Cleaning: Simple cleaning with soap and water or a composite cleaner is typically sufficient to remove surface dirt and stains.
  • No Staining/Sealing: Unlike wood, composite decking does not require staining or sealing, as its material is designed to resist weathering, fading, and staining.
  • Inspection: While more resistant to damage than wood, it’s still important to check composite decks for any issues with the fasteners or structural integrity.

Seasonal Deck Maintenance Tips

A deck is more than just an outdoor space; it’s a year-round retreat that requires regular care to maintain its beauty and functionality. Whether you have a wood or composite deck, understanding how to maintain it through the seasons is key to extending its life and ensuring it’s ready to enjoy whenever you are.

Here’s a seasonal guide for how to maintain a deck that covers both wood and composite materials:

Spring: Refresh and Prepare

  • Post-Winter Cleaning: Start the season with a thorough cleaning. For wood decks, use a mild wood cleaner to remove mold, mildew, and grime accumulated over the winter. Composite decks can be cleaned with soap and water or a cleaner designed for composite materials.
  • Inspection: Check for any damage such as loose boards, popped nails, or signs of rot (wood decks) and cracks or splits (composite decks). Make necessary repairs to ensure safety and integrity.
  • Seal or Stain (Wood Decks): After cleaning, apply a water-repellent sealant or stain to protect the wood from moisture and UV damage throughout the year.

Summer: Protect and Enjoy

  • Sun Protection: Consider applying a UV-resistant finish to wood decks to prevent fading and wear. For composite decks, use rugs or mats approved for composite decking to minimize sun exposure and heat buildup.
  • Wear and Tear Inspection: High traffic can lead to wear. Mid-summer, inspect your deck for any new signs of damage or areas that may require maintenance, adjusting as needed to keep everything in top shape.

Fall: Clear and Prevent

  • Leaf Removal: Fallen leaves and debris can trap moisture and lead to mold and mildew growth. Regularly sweep your deck to keep it clear. For wood decks, this is especially crucial to prevent decay.
  • Gutter Check: Ensure gutters and downspouts are directing water away from your deck to prevent pooling and damage.

Winter: Secure and Protect

  • Furniture Storage: Remove or cover outdoor furniture to protect it from the elements and prevent it from damaging the deck surface.
  • Snow Removal: It’s recommended for proper deck maintenance to use a plastic shovel to clear snow off your deck to prevent moisture accumulation and potential damage. Metal shovels can damage deck boards. Avoid salt or chemical deicers, which can harm deck finishes and materials.
  • Pre-Winter Inspection: Before the first snowfall, do a final check for any maintenance needs, particularly focusing on securing railings and checking for loose boards or potential hazards.

By following these seasonal deck maintenance tips, you can ensure your deck, whether wood or composite, remains a safe, enjoyable space for years to come. Scenarios Requiring Professional Attention

  • Structural Concerns: Signs such as sagging, loose boards, or unstable railings require immediate attention as they can be dangerous hazards. These issues may not only indicate surface damage but could also point to deeper, structural weaknesses that compromise safety.
  • Major Restoration Projects: If your deck is showing its age (or has seen better days) and you’re considering a significant overhaul, professional guidance can help reimagine and execute your vision while adhering to the latest building codes and standards.
  • Persistent Issues: Repeated mold growth, discoloration, or decay, despite regular maintenance, may indicate underlying problems that require professional solutions. Royal Deck has all the answers!
  • Pre-Purchase or Sale Inspection: Ensuring a deck is structurally sound and up to code is crucial when buying or selling a property. A professional inspection can provide peace of mind and transparency in real estate transactions.
